edit 06.01.18:
- Uploaded v3 of the first design, made it longer because the bed cable sometimes went over its end towards the extruder and back over it during some large prints. It wouldnt tug on it but would push it bit by bit. So this is better. No "logo" anymore either.
Added a gcode i did in ideamaker with the model flipped over so it has minimal supports.
This is not essential but more of a piece of mind addon-mod for CR10.
I noticed that even with Strain Relief Upgrade (https://www.thingiverse.com/thing:2186203) which is essential, the cable in the back still tends to scrape over the corner of the printer main structure. So if you also dont like seeing that, or getting the occasional tug, this little mod will prevent that and give you piece of mind.
